Total reliability and guaranteed safety, combined with low maintenance costs, are vital when selecting components for integration into your DC distribution. Photovoltaic and DC installations must be able to perform in all conditions, even extreme operating environments. INOSYS LBS have been specifically engineered and tested for the most demanding applications. The latest additions to the range incorporate a trip function - compliant with rapid shutdown per Section 690.12 of NEC 2014. Compatible with Arc-Fault Detection System, the disconnect switch with trip functionality delivers a complete AFCI solution in accordance with UL1699B.

INOSYS LBSLoad Break Switches incorporating tripping function from 100 to 1250 A, up to 1500 VDC - DC and PV applications
Advantages
• High-performanceswitchinginacompactfootprintINOSYS LBS switches integrate a patented technology that offers breaking capacity of 500 VDC per pole and significant reductions in power losses. And all in a compact unit !
•Safeoperation- Reliable position indication and visible
blades with perfect arc containment.- ON, OFF and TRIP positions are stable:
resistant to voltage fluctuations.- The trip position provides complete
disconnection and isolation.- The opening and closing of the switch
are fully independent from the speed of the operation.
•Trippingfunction:flexibleandrobust- No nuisance tripping.- Shunt-trip or under voltage from 24 to
220 VDC and from 24 to 230 VAC- Wide operating temperature range: -25
to +70 °C (-15 to +160 °F).- Fast disconnection (< 50 ms) for rapid
firefighter shutdown, compliant with installation standards.
- Compatible with virtually any Arc- Fault Detection System, including the RESYS AFD solution.
•Noderatingupto55°C(131°F)
•Modularsolutionforaflexibleconfiguration- Disconnect up to three circuits with one
switch: a compact and cost effective solution for recombiner and inverter applications.
- Compatible with single or dual polarity switching: the same switch can be used for installation with either grounded or floating networks.
•Easytoinstall- Mechanism can be centered or left
aligned to accommodate installation requirements.
- Wiring: a complete non polarization of the switch allows all possible type of wiring and connections.
- Integrated auxiliary contacts and tripping coil.

Electrical characteristics
Rated current per IEC 60947-3 160 A 250 A 315 A 400 A 630 A 800 A 1000 A 1250 ARating per UL98B 100 A - 250 A 400 A 500 A 600 A 800 A 1000 ARated voltage per pole 600 VDCRated voltage, 2 poles in series 1000 VDCRated voltage, 3 poles in series 1500 VDC
